bodewig 2005/05/10 06:57:48 Modified: . build.xml Log: Add SHA1 checksums, prepare stuff for http://www.apache.org/dist/java-repository/ Revision Changes Path 1.467 +32 -0 ant/build.xml Index: build.xml =================================================================== RCS file: /home/cvs/ant/build.xml,v retrieving revision 1.466 retrieving revision 1.467 diff -u -r1.466 -r1.467 --- build.xml 24 Mar 2005 08:29:42 -0000 1.466 +++ build.xml 10 May 2005 13:57:48 -0000 1.467 @@ -135,6 +135,8 @@ <property name="src.dist.docs" value="${src.dist.dir}/docs"/> <property name="src.dist.lib" value="${src.dist.dir}/lib"/> + <property name="java-repository.dir" value="java-repository/ant/jars"/> + <!-- =================================================================== Set up selectors to be used by javac, junit and jar to exclude @@ -1188,9 +1190,11 @@ <target name="main_distribution" description="--> creates the zip and tar distributions"> <delete dir="${dist.name}"/> + <delete dir="${java-repository.dir}"/> <mkdir dir="${dist.base}"/> <mkdir dir="${dist.base}/src"/> <mkdir dir="${dist.base}/bin"/> + <mkdir dir="${java-repository.dir}"/> <antcall inheritAll="false" target="internal_dist"> <param name="dist.dir" value="${dist.name}"/> @@ -1231,6 +1235,20 @@ <bzip2 destfile="${dist.base}/bin/${dist.name}-bin.tar.bz2" src="${dist.base}/bin/${dist.name}-bin.tar"/> <delete file="${dist.base}/bin/${dist.name}-bin.tar"/> + + <copy todir="${java-repository.dir}"> + <fileset dir="${dist.name}/lib"> + <include name="ant*.jar"/> + </fileset> + <mapper type="glob" from="*.jar" to="*-${version}.jar"/> + </copy> + <checksum fileext=".md5"> + <fileset dir="${java-repository.dir}" includes="*${version}.jar"/> + </checksum> + <checksum fileext=".sha1" algorithm="SHA"> + <fileset dir="${java-repository.dir}" includes="*${version}.jar"/> + </checksum> + <delete dir="${dist.name}"/> <checksum fileext=".md5"> <fileset dir="${dist.base}/bin/"> @@ -1239,6 +1257,13 @@ <exclude name="**/*.md5"/> </fileset> </checksum> + <checksum fileext=".sha1" algorithm="SHA"> + <fileset dir="${dist.base}/bin/"> + <include name="**/*"/> + <exclude name="**/*.asc"/> + <exclude name="**/*.md5"/> + </fileset> + </checksum> <antcall inheritAll="false" target="src-dist"> <param name="src.dist.dir" value="${dist.name}"/> @@ -1279,6 +1304,13 @@ <exclude name="**/*.md5"/> </fileset> </checksum> + <checksum fileext=".sha1" algorithm="SHA"> + <fileset dir="${dist.base}/src/"> + <include name="**/*"/> + <exclude name="**/*.asc"/> + <exclude name="**/*.md5"/> + </fileset> + </checksum> </target> <target name="distribution" depends="main_distribution"
--------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]